What Is An Encoder Motor. motor encoders are rotary encoder measures the position and speed of a motor's shaft. encoders are devices that sense the speed and position of electric motors and send feedback signals to control components. an encoder motor is a motor with a rotary encoder that provides feedback to the system by tracking the speed or position of the shaft. encoders are a type of sensor used primarily to detect the speed, position, angle, distance, or count of mechanical motion. a motor encoder is a device that converts the angular position or motion of a shaft or axle to an analog or digital code.
